CIONIC and researchers at Cleveland State University are conducting a research study for adults with multiple sclerosis (MS).
The study aims to understand the clinical impact of the Cionic Neural Sleeve1 for individuals diagnosed with MS using outcomes related to fatigue, spasticity, quality of life, and activity levels.

Participation in the study may take up to 18 weeks. The study will require volunteers to visit Cleveland State University’s research lab in Cleveland, Ohio on 3 occasions and take part in a walking program. The 12-week walking program requires participants to walk for at least 15 minutes per day for 5 days per week while wearing an activity monitor and the Cionic Neural Sleeve for a 6-week period. The 90-minute lab visits will require participants to complete assessments of spasticity, balance, walking, range of motion, and strength. Participants will also complete questionnaires about the impact of MS and their daily activity level. Participants will receive an Amazon gift card for each testing session completed.
